
“Mr. Darcy’s Proper Behaviour” is the third and final book in the Hot Mush Series - “A Blissful Marriage”. It is a novella of approximately 35.000 words. The stories in this series are meant for a mature audience only and follow the Darcys during the first months of their marriage. Through their growing love and passion and their adjustment to society’s demands, they also demonstrate their excellent characters and compassionate nature. Mr. and Mrs. Darcy are lost in their blissful relationship and still yearning for each other as a couple deeply in love, yet they are still attentive to those in need around them and are willing to do everything in their power to provide help and support. The third book in the series shows a Mr. Darcy, who is less proper than usual. This passionate man is willing to fight villains who threaten those dear to him.. Darcy’s honour and sense of duty induce him to support his wife’s generous involvement in saving innocent lives. The approval or rejection of London’s ton varies, but the Darcys’ actions remain loyal to their beliefs and values. “Mr. Darcy’s Proper Behaviour” – like the previous two books in the series – contains explicit and detailed love scenes, appropriate for adult readers only. There are also several references (although mostly implied or just mentioned, not detailed) to child abuse, that might affect some readers.
